So you had a tuner turn the AFM off correct? That means the lifters cam and associated parts are still in the vehicle. And still liable to fail.. Hence loud lifter noises. "If" that is what your experiencing.

I couldn't tell ya how to go about getting GM to fix your issue as I do my own. Even when mine was under warranty. Trust issues...

So you think it's more noticeable.now with afm delete(8 cylinders all the time) because there all 8 lifters in use all the time instead of 4,8,4,8 type scenario?no engine code yet, may not be broken to throw a code possibly just out of adjustment?

Posted

I honestly think it would not of made a difference as the same parts inside the engine are still installed. There are threads here where guys turned off the AFM and still had lifter failures and rightfully so as the parts that make it all happen are still used in the engine.

Like I always say its just a matter of when these fail. Kinda like "Wait for it..."

How long did it take you to do?  I got quoted $6700 to install a stage 2 cam with the DOD delete kit at my local performance shop.

Posted (edited)
36 minutes ago, Kailua Knight said:

How long did it take you to do?  I got quoted $6700 to install a stage 2 cam with the DOD delete kit at my local performance shop.

I paid some youngster from Fort Worth that worked at the Chevy house, he charged me 500$ for labor plus the fluids (let’s say another 100$) he did it over the weekend at his house. I supplied all my parts, at the time I didn’t want to change the stall if I got a different cam, so I kept the cam close to oem/ factory specs without the afm/dod. Lifter 7# collapsed 2 months after putting 5000$ down on it so money was very tight at the time and didn’t have warranty on it

    • Question @diyer2 on this line if you please. Are you saying the shudder is the system turning on and off at the frequency of the shudder? Guess I'm asking if you are saying you have seen it do this with the bi-direction scan tool in graph mode? If so have you been able to discern the 'trigger'. Something is telling to cycle rapidly.    My truck just started doing this recently. 197K on the clock. My response has been M5 anything under 55 mph. I treat it like a lugging stick shift. Gear down and let it spin a bit. Engauge M5, then tow mode and then M6 lets the trans stay in 5th but the AFM is active. Smooth like Skippy.    My thought was that as a machine ages the friction gets lower and as the system is load based, the lower friction would allow it to turn on at ever lower rpm until it reaches the lugging point. And yes I am ignorant of any minimum rpm requirement for the system. If you know that would be useful information.    As you know I run a Scan-Gauge II which allows me to watch the On/Off of the signal to the VLOM. While in the shudder mode I'm not seeing is cycle at that frequency or at all for that matter outside the triggers @newdude posted a few years back. Now is it possible that the refresh rate isn't fast enough to catch it? Maybe. It is why I asked my first question about graphing and trigging parameter.     As we have observed from members here the failure point is all over the map miles wise as you note yourself in your opening post. That by itself begs a few questions like fellows that comment on these lifters failing even after the system has been disabled. Long after. 😬   https://www.enginelabs.com/news/tech-tips-replacing-ls-active-fuel-management-lifters-with-melling/   The Gen5 lifters operate the same as the LS versions. In fact they are the same lifter.    https://www.enginelabs.com/tech-stories/sorting-out-gen-v-lt-lifter-failure-with-a-simple-valvetrain-fix/

    • GM Global A pickups 2019-2022 can do OTA programming for the radio.  GM VIP (GM Global B) can do OTAs for almost every module on board.  So a 2022.5 and newer pickup can do OTAs for recalls like the 2.7 fuel flow recall.  EVs get OTAs that improve one pedal driving, radio issues, HVAC issues, updated battery management software, etc.     So age of the vehicle/what GM electrical platform its on will alter what amount of updates can be pushed on OTAs.
